The Geneva Conventions comprise four treaties, and three additional protocols, that establish the standards of international lawfor humanitarian treatment in war. The singular term Geneva Convention usually denotes the agreements of 1949, negotiated in the aftermath of the Second World War(1939–45), which updated the terms of the two 1929 treaties, and added two new conventions.
